ICT Teacher – Great Barr, Birmingham – January 2010
• ICT Teacher Required
• January start
• To Key Stages 3 and 4 & 5
• 2344 pupils on the roll
• Full-time position
Our client school is looking to recruit an enthusiastic teacher who is able to motivating pupils to achieve their full potential. You will be able to teach across the full age and ability range and will be a strong team player with a willingness to share ideas and to develop yourself professionally.
They are happy to consider applications from experienced teachers anxious to get into a school in which their subject has a high profile, or from NQTs.
They have an NQT Induction Programme which is recognised by the Local Authority as an exemplar of outstanding practice. With in excess of 110 TLR positions across the School, this is an excellent place for a talented, ambitious professional to commence and/or develop their career.
The School is committed to developing staff of the highest calibre and has a busy schedule of weekly INSET courses available to all teaching staff.
The School has a highly developed and well established programme for providing NQT’s with the necessary support to achieve a successful and smooth first year in their new careers.
In such a large school, there are plentiful career development opportunities and many staff members choose to remain seeking promotion within the School.
